WebAug 30, 2024 · Lake Davis is located seven miles north of Portola, California. This lake was created in 1967 for recreational opportunities. The Lake Davis Recreation Area offers a wide variety of summer outdoor experiences including: camping, picnicking, fishing, hunting, boating, mountain biking, swimming and wildlife viewing. WebLightning Tree Campground (5,800 feet) is one of three family-friendly campgrounds located in the Lake Davis Recreation Area. The lake was formed by damming Grizzly Creek in 1967. The purpose of the lake was to provide water for the town of Portola, improve area fishing and provide recreation opportunities. The 32 miles of shoreline …

The lake is accessible for year-round use, withe excellent fishing throughout the year, the best time is spring and early summer. Fish & Wildlife decided to manage this lake as a “high cost” low “yielding trophy trout fishing lake.” Some fishermen prefer Lake Davis over other lakes since water skiing, and jet skis are not … See more The Lake Davis trail goes along much of the shore of Lake Davis past CatFish Cove and meanders up past Lightning Tree Campground. This trail is open for equestrian use, biking, and trail running. See more Hiking at Lake Davis gives the added benefit of being a hotspot for wildlife viewing, birding, and viewing wildflowers in the spring. For additional hotspots for birding and spotting wildflowers throughout Plumas County, visit … See more Smith Peak Lookout is an active lookout tower that sits above Lake Davis, and as you would expect, it offers 360-degree views. You get a bird’s-eye view of Lake Davis and the Mills Peak look-out across the valley. See more Spring is the best time for wildflowers. With vivid displays of purple camas, larkspur, yellow meadow buttercups, butterweed, and others. See more WebLake Davis is one of the premier fishing lakes in Northern California. Skiing and jet skiing are not allowed on Lake Davis, making this a quieter place to relax and enjoy the outdoors. ...
